Recommended setup for Teriyaki Chicken
BEST STARTAir Fryer method
375°F for 4 to 7 minutesBest quality. This approach is strongest for crisp exteriors and fried foods for teriyaki chicken. Preheat if your basket model heats slowly.
Air Fryer
Air Fryer recovery setup
375°F with midpoint checkLeave visible gaps between pieces so the surface can re-crisp instead of steaming. For teriyaki chicken, a light oil mist helps breaded foods recover color and crunch.
Avoiding dry spots in teriyaki chicken
💡 Method reminders
- •Store teriyaki chicken in shallow portions so reheating stays even the next day.
- •Use the method that matches the texture you want back from teriyaki chicken.
- •Stop reheating as soon as the center is hot so teriyaki chicken does not dry out.
❌ Common misses for this method
- •Very high heat from the start if teriyaki chicken is dense or sauce-heavy
- •Overcrowded pans or baskets that trap steam around teriyaki chicken
- •Repeated reheats of the same portion
